forked from qt-creator/qt-creator
Since we do not support Qt < 5.15 anymore, and as a first step for getting rid of our special FindQt5.cmake. Change-Id: Icc5dbaf9b0a3a622b1f609ff114b9decb6d2856c Reviewed-by: <github-actions-qt-creator@cristianadam.eu> Reviewed-by: Cristian Adam <cristian.adam@qt.io>
43 lines
1.0 KiB
CMake
43 lines
1.0 KiB
CMake
add_qtc_test(tst_manual_proparser
|
|
MANUALTEST
|
|
DEPENDS Qt::Core Qt::Core5Compat
|
|
DEFINES
|
|
"QMAKE_BUILTIN_PRFS"
|
|
"QT_NO_CAST_TO_ASCII"
|
|
"QT_RESTRICTED_CAST_FROM_ASCII"
|
|
"QT_USE_QSTRINGBUILDER"
|
|
"PROEVALUATOR_FULL"
|
|
"PROEVALUATOR_CUMULATIVE"
|
|
"PROEVALUATOR_INIT_PROPS"
|
|
INCLUDES
|
|
"${PROJECT_SOURCE_DIR}/src/shared/proparser/"
|
|
"${PROJECT_SOURCE_DIR}/src/libs/"
|
|
SOURCES
|
|
main.cpp
|
|
)
|
|
|
|
extend_qtc_test(tst_manual_proparser
|
|
SOURCES_PREFIX "${PROJECT_SOURCE_DIR}/src/shared/proparser/"
|
|
SOURCES
|
|
ioutils.cpp ioutils.h
|
|
profileevaluator.cpp profileevaluator.h
|
|
proitems.cpp proitems.h
|
|
proparser.qrc
|
|
qmake_global.h
|
|
qmakebuiltins.cpp
|
|
qmakeevaluator.cpp qmakeevaluator.h qmakeevaluator_p.h
|
|
qmakeglobals.cpp qmakeglobals.h
|
|
qmakeparser.cpp qmakeparser.h
|
|
qmakevfs.cpp qmakevfs.h
|
|
registry.cpp registry_p.h
|
|
)
|
|
|
|
extend_qtc_test(tst_manual_proparser CONDITION WIN32
|
|
DEPENDS advapi32
|
|
)
|
|
|
|
extend_qtc_test(tst_manual_proparser
|
|
PROPERTIES
|
|
OUTPUT_NAME "testreader"
|
|
)
|